EU's planned tobacco curbs break WTO rules, Malawi says<p><a href="http://news.yahoo.com/eus-planned-tobacco-curbs-break-wto-rules-malawi-070007379--finance.html"><img src="http://l.yimg.com/bt/api/res/1.2/U8CDKB0HTjxDeXt75bKNQw--/YXBwaWQ9eW5ld3M7Zmk9ZmlsbDtoPTg2O3E9ODU7dz0xMzA-/http://media.zenfs.com/en_ZA/News/Reuters/2013-03-16T093532Z_1_AJOE92F0QNE00_RTROPTP_2_OZATP-EU-TOBACCO-WTO-20130316.JPG" width="130" height="86" alt="(Blank Headline Received)" align="left" title="(Blank Headline Received)" border="0" /></a>By Tom Miles GENEVA (Reuters) - The European Union's plans for tough new anti-smoking rules would break international trade rules, Malawi has told the World Trade Organization, signaling a potential legal challenge from the developing world. Malawi, one of the world's poorest countries, is concerned that EU plans to make cigarettes less attractive to new smokers will hurt a sector which provides more than 60 percent of its foreign exchange earnings, according to a WTO survey in 2010. ...</p><br clear="all"/>
